[Reflux esophagitis: operative procedures in the adult: gastropexy (author's transl)]
Abstract
Fundophrenicopexy is an effective procedure for repairing important mechanical parts of the LES. Pre- and postoperative measurement of pressure in 52 patients demonstrated an increase from x = 20.1 mm Hg to x = 39.25 mm Hg. Fundophrenicopexy is the more simple surgical management compared with fundoplication and is followed less frequently by complications. If anatomical conditions allow, fundophrenicopexy is preferred in surgical treatment of reflux esophagitis.
